Skagit County can be found in the western area of Washington. Mount Vernon – is the county seat. Skagit County has a total population of 125619 and was formed in 1883.

Skagit County has a total area of 1,730 square miles. The zip codes in Skagit County are 98221, 98232, 98233, 98235, 98237, 98238, 98255, 98257, 98263, 98267, 98273, 98274, 98283, 98284.

Sending A Mail/Package

Prisoners can get mail while they are at the Skagit County Jail. Mail will be conveyed to the detainees Monday until Friday. There is no end of the week conveyance. Mail will not be conveyed to detainees that cannot show their jail distinguishing proof armband.

Inmates at Skagit County Jail can write letters to their family or friends. All writing supplies will need to be purchased by the inmate in the Skagit County Jail commissary.

At Skagit County Jail all customary mail will be opened before being given to detainees to evacuate cash and some other stash. Notwithstanding, legitimate mail significance mail originating from lawful direction will be immaculate as it will be opened before the prisoner.

Sending Money

Money is a vital part of the lives of Skagit County Jail. Cash can be sent to the Skagit County Jail for prisoners to use for the grocery store. Nonetheless, when sending cash to the Skagit County Jail, you should utilize the US Postal Help and you can just utilize Postal Prepaid Cash Requests, standard cash requests, or government checks. Be that as it may, money, finance checks, charge card numbers, and individual checks are not allowed.

Phone Calls

Skagit County Jail utilizes Worldwide Tel Connection as their telephone specialist organization. You can subsidize their phone account by setting off to their official site. Or then again you can call them at 360-336-9448 or fax at360-336-9390.

The inmates, while at the Skagit County Jail, will be allowed to make phone calls during the daytime only hours. Calls are checked and restricted to 15 minutes. There is no three-way calling. Calls can and will end if rules are not followed.

Visitation

Detainees can get guests while at the Skagit County Jail. Guests for prisoners are a benefit. This benefit can and will be removed without notice.

Guests must arrange before visiting. You can plan a visit by calling 360-336-9448. The line is open Monday through Friday from 11:30 am until either arrangement is filled.

In case of an office lock down or a crisis, all meeting at Skagit County Jail will be dropped. All guests must have a substantial personal ID in their ownership. The ID card must be official. ID must be introduced to remedial staff upon demand.

All guests must be in any event 18 years old. Youngsters younger than 18, will be permitted to visit, yet should be joined by a parent or legitimate gatekeeper. Visits are constrained to 2 grown-ups and 1 kid, or 1 grown-up and 2 youngsters one after another. Kids must be directed consistently; guardians are answerable for kids while at the Skagit County Jail.
